    The beta appears to be open now. I'm having a blast with it. DOTA and LOL had too much learning curve and toxicity for me to get into. I really appreciate the lack of items, they felt more like I had to memorize a bunch of precalculated builds rather than making interesting strategic choices in the moment. Team xp I think opens up some possibility for interesting Lords- either to ignore or focus on lanes. The Lost Vikings for instance are all about splitting up to soak all three lanes letting the rest of your team focus on map objectives. ifthen#1122 if anyone needs a little more Uther in their life. Having a reasonable group you can make plans with makes a huge difference.

  9. Webcomics

    Erfworld takes what could have been a pretty cheesy premise- strategy game nerd gets sucked into a punny world resembling a strategy game- and gives it good art, characters with personality and motive, and a conflict that amounts to more than good vs evil. I can't recommend it enough.
